MAXIM Antibacterial Hand Soap is an industrial and institutional use soap that is effective in removing bacteria, and it is enhanced with emollients that make the hands smoother. It is a thick pearlescent antiseptic soap. The soap comes in a gallon. This soap contains 0.19% Propisic:Agete Antibacerno. To use, apply a small amount of the soap, and then rub hands together for 30 seconds. Rinse with water and make sure it does not come into contact with eyes. Keep out of the reach of children.
